Wiktionary
ERGODICITY, noun. (uncountable) The condition of being ergodic
ERGODICITY, noun. (countable) The extent to which something is ergodic
Dictionary definition
ERGODICITY, noun. An attribute of stochastic systems; generally, a system that tends in probability to a limiting form that is independent of the initial conditions.
